If you read Marcus Aurelius, Epictetus (both the Enchiridion and the Discourses), then all of Seneca, you'll be fine.

Also read "Philosophy of Chrysippus" by Josiah Gould since there's only fragments left of Chrysippus.

Pretty much this. Those three are the surviving full texts of Stoicism. They're worth multiple reads.

Hadot's Inner Citadel is a rich text for understanding Meditations, and Stoicism in general. Pierre Hadot's works are good for practical philosophy in general. He's very academic, but still accessible to the dedicated general reader.
